About the role
We are excited to offer four fantastic internship opportunities (two in Napa and two in Sonoma/Carneros) where you will gain hands-on experience in the diverse and unique vineyards of the Napa, Sonoma, and Carneros regions. From valley floor to hillside viticulture, and from the gentle slopes of Carneros Pinot Noir to mountaintop Napa Cabernet, you'll have the opportunity to experience it all. Our 32 vineyard properties span roughly 4,000 acres, providing a rare chance to experience a wide range of growing conditions. Few internships can match this breadth of experience, and you'll be working alongside a dedicated team committed to producing top-quality wines.
As a Viticulture Harvest Intern, you will work alongside the Viticulturist and Assistant Viticulturist. Some of the responsibilities for this role include:
+ Participate in harvest activities, including collecting phenology data, taking maturity samples, and assisting in crop estimation.
+ Lead soil sampling analysis, water status monitoring, and pest and disease scouting.
+ Use Geographical Information System (GIS) and other agriculture technology to enhance precision farming.
+ Conduct data analysis for on-going research and other assigned projects.
Position starts: May-July and goes through October, season dependent (flexible start-date).
